What Is a Urine Drug Screen?

In Stockton, MO, urine drug testing reviews the presence of drugs and their breakdown products in a urine sample. This method is widely preferred in workplace and regulatory environments due to its non-intrusive nature, economic value, and extensive coverage of substances within a useful detection timeframe.

  • Ensures sampling is conducted under chain-of-custody protocols for compliance.
  • Offers detection of both the parent drugs and their metabolites as they are expelled in urine.
  • Reflects prior drug exposure during the detection window rather than current intoxication levels.

How It Works

Collection

  • An individual in Stockton, MO provides a specimen in a secured container, either observed or unobserved, depending on stipulated program regulations.
  • Checks on specimen validity may entail tests for creatinine levels, specific gravity, and pH balance.

Testing Methodology

Interpreting Results

  • In Stockton, MO, the initial phase involves immunoassay screening, offering a swift and affordable evaluation method.
  • For presumptive positive results, confirmatory testing (e.g., GC/MS or LC/MS/MS) is employed.
  • Cutoff levels, expressed in nanograms per milliliter (ng/mL), define whether the results are positive or negative.

Detection Windows

Various factors, including the specific drug, frequency of usage, metabolic rate, hydration status, body composition, and the sensitivity of the testing method in Stockton, MO can affect detection capabilities. Generally, many drugs can be identified within a 1 to 3-day period, although substances such as cannabinoids may extend this timeframe for chronic users.

What Is a Hair Drug Screen?

In the state of Stockton, MO, hair drug screening utilizes a small sample of hair to identify drugs and their metabolites that have been present in the bloodstream and subsequently incorporated into the hair shaft. With hair growing at a slow rate and storing drug metabolites for extended periods, this method offers one of the longest detection windows among various testing techniques, making it particularly effective for detecting chronic or long-term drug usage.

  • Typically, 100–120 strands are cut close to the scalp, approximately 1.5 inches of hair length is used for the test.
  • This method can reflect around a 90-day period of potential drug exposure, contingent on the length of hair sampled.
  • In Stockton, MO, a broad array of substances such as amphetamines, opioids, cocaine, marijuana, and PCP can be tested.

How It Works

Collection

  • A collection specialist carefully extracts a minor segment of hair, generally from the crown, ensuring compliance with chain-of-custody protocols.
  • The acquired sample is labeled, sealed, and dispatched to a certified laboratory.
  • If scalp hair is unavailable, alternate collection sites, like body hair, may be employed.

Testing Methodology

  • Samples undergo cleaning and preparation to remove any external drug contaminants.
  • An initial immunoassay spot-check identifies presence of drug classes.
  • GC/MS or LC/MS/MS methods confirm any positive initial readings for accurate identification.
  • Nanogram per milligram (ng/mg) threshold levels follow SAMHSA and lab protocols.

Interpreting Results

  • Negative: No substance is detected above the lab-specified cutoff level in Stockton, MO.
  • Positive: A substance or metabolite is identified and verified through secondary rigorous testing.
  • Inconclusive/Rejected: Sample quantity may be insufficient, or contamination present, necessitating a reevaluation or recollection.

Detection Windows

In Stockton, MO, hair analysis offers the most extended drug detection window compared to other testing methods. A standard hair sample measuring 1.5 inches typically reflects up to 90 days of potential drug exposure. Longer hair length can extend the detection period, dependent on the growth rate of approximately 0.5 inches per month. However, this method, whether employed in Stockton, MO or elsewhere, does not identify recent use (specifically within the last 7–10 days).

Benefits

  • A prolonged detection window, extending up to 90 days or longer, is a significant advantage.
  • Hair tests are challenging to adulterate or replace, contrasting the vulnerabilities of urine specimens.
  • They provide clarity regarding chronic or repeated drug use patterns.
  • In Stockton, MO, the sample collection process is efficient, minimally invasive, and restroom facilities are unnecessary.
